Enrollment For this enrollment, each woman being enrolled will need to have some light source a candle with matches, a flashlight with batteries, etc. (use whatever is financially feasible and/or available). The program is written for several women to participate. If you have a small group, the program may be modified for one or two people to read the parts. At the front of your meeting area have a table arranged with your light sources: an oil lamp, a small desk lamp, a heavy duty flashlight, and a string of Christmas lights. As each source is introduced, turn on the light. Corps Officer: For our enrollment today, we will be exploring each aspect of the four-fold focus of Women s Ministry: Worship, Education, Fellowship and Service. When it rains, the water droplets in the air refract the pure light of the sun into its many component colors and a rainbow is formed. Like light that is made up of many colors, the quality of our program is measured in the balance of its parts. Only by creating a place for worship, education, fellowship, and service can we fulfill the mission of the Women s Ministry programs of The Salvation Army to: bring women into the knowledge of Jesus Christ encourage their full potential in influencing family, friends and community equip them for growth in personal understanding and life skills, [and to] address issues which affect particularly women and their families in the world. 10 Women s Ministry Chaplin: Lights the oil lamp. The oil lamp represents WORSHIP. There s an old Sunday School chorus that says: Give me oil in my lamp, Keep me burning, Give me oil in my lamp, I pray. Give me oil in my lamp, Keep me burning, Keep me burning Till the break of day. Sing hosanna! sing hosanna! Sing hosanna to the King of kings! Sing hosanna! sing hosanna! Sing hosanna to the King! 10 International Mission taken from http://www.salvationarmy.org/ihq/wmabout, accessed on March 30, 2015

Once the oil in an oil lamp runs out, the flame quickly flickers and dies. Zechariah 4 describes a lamp that is continually supplied oil by two olive trees. In verse 6, it is revealed that the continual supply of oil is the Holy Spirit. Like an oil lamp, we never want our supply of the spirit to run dry. We long for a continual supply. Regular worship is one way for us to top off our reserves and to make sure that no matter the circumstance we will keep burning. Women s Ministry Education Chair: Switches on the lamp. Whether it s working on embroidery, filling in a crossword puzzle, or getting lost in a good book; it is hard to beat the usefulness of a well-placed lamp. Lamps illuminate the dark corners of our rooms. They create mood and they give us refuge from the glare of an overhead light. This lamp symbolizes EDUCATION. Through education, the dark corners of our world are brought into light. We become aware of issues like human trafficking and the role we can take in changing our world for the better. Educational programs also help us to lead more interesting and full lives through the discoveries and skills we acquire. Perhaps most importantly, education helps us to identify and avoid pitfalls that we would not be able to see in our ignorant darkness. Jesus warned against following the Pharisees who wander in ignorance. Leave them; they are blind guides. If a blind man leads a blind man, both will fall into a pit. (Matthew 15:14) Women s Ministry Fellowship Chair: Plug in the string of lights. What else would symbolize FELLOWSHIP? A string of brightly lit lights always announces a party. Of course, we would never use a string of lights to light up a room or to illuminate delicate needlework. The only real utility of these lights is to make us happy. King Solomon writes in the book of Ecclesiastes that there is a time for everything, a time to weep and a time to laugh. (Eccl: 3: 4a) It is important for us to always make time for laughter when we are together, but is it also important for us to be able to weep together and to share our struggles. Fellowship is often noted in our program as times to sit and have coffee or to play games, but fellowship is not really the activity that has been planned. Fellowship occurs when we are brave enough to let our true selves out. Like a string of lights, real fellowship happens in small moments of clarity and transparency. Women s Ministry Service Chair: Switch on the flashlight. Chances are you know where to find one of these in case of an emergency. From the side of the road to the plumber s toolbox, flashlights guide our way. No one wants to be stuck without a flashlight on a dark night without power. In the Parable of the Sheep and the Goats, Jesus says,

When the Son of Man comes in his glory, and all the angels with him, he will sit on his throne in heavenly glory. All the nations will be gathered before him, and he will separate the people one from another as a shepherd separates the sheep from the goats. He will put the sheep on his right and the goats on his left. Then the King will say to those on his right, Come, you who are blessed by my Father; take your inheritance, the kingdom prepared for you since the creation of the world. Matthew 25:31-34 (NIV) What is the difference between the beloved sheep and the cursed goats? Jesus goes on to explain that the sheep ministered to those in need. They allowed themselves to be the flashlight in God s toolbox by shining his light in dark places. As for the goats, things do not turn out so well. Then he will say to those on his left, Depart from me, you who are cursed, into the eternal fire prepared for the devil and his angels. For I was hungry and you gave me nothing to eat, I was thirsty and you gave me nothing to drink, I was a stranger and you did not invite me in, I needed clothes and you did not clothe me, I was sick and in prison and you did not look after me. They also will answer, Lord, when did we see you hungry or thirsty or a stranger or needing clothes or sick or in prison, and did not help you? He will reply, I tell you the truth, whatever you did not do for one of the least of these, you did not do for me. Matthew 25:41-45 (NIV) The SERVICE we do in Women s Ministry should be more than a token program once in a blue moon, a way to fulfill our commitments, or even a means to receive glory. Ideally, service is our way to minister to Christ himself, to be used by him to shine a light to others. Women s Ministry Secretary: With all of these, it is important to remember that light needs a source. Flashlights need batteries, candles need flames, bulbs need electricity, and even the new day depends on the sun. If we are going to shine, we must become intimately connected with the source of our light, Jesus Christ. Jesus said, I am the light of the world. Whoever follows me will never walk in darkness, but will have the light of life." (John 8:12) Today as you are enrolled as new members of Women s Ministries, I would like to present you not only with something that will help you to shine, but also with the source of its power (flashlight with batteries, candle with matches, etc.). The two MUST go together. You cannot have one without the other. It is my prayer that here at The Salvation Aarmy, you have also

found a group that you cannot do without. You will continue to make our group one of your sources for Worship, Fellowship, Education and Service. Corps Officer: (calling each woman who will be enrolled forward) Will you now promise that you will, to the best of your ability, uphold the purposes of the Women s Ministry Organization by: 1st Giving yourself in the willing service to others 2nd Uniting in joyful fellowship with one another 3rd Endeavoring to gain understanding through education 4th Seeking ever to give God His rightful place in your home and in your individual life, that you may worship him in Spirit and in truth. If this is your desire, will you step forward as you name is called and receive your membership card which signifies your affiliation with The Salvation Army. Women s Ministry Chaplin: Offers prayer of dedication. Song Shine Jesus Shine"
